The global quantum warfare market size was valued at USD 1.80 billion in 2025. The market is projected to grow from USD 2.05 billion in 2026 to USD 6.50 billion by 2034, exhibiting a CAGR of 15.5% during the forecast period. North America dominated the quantum warfare market, with a market share of 38.33% in 2025.
The Quantum Warfare Market is transforming modern military strategies by integrating quantum technologies into defense systems to enhance secure communications, intelligence, surveillance, and navigation capabilities. Governments worldwide are increasingly recognizing quantum threats and opportunities, leading to increased investments in quantum-safe encryption, quantum sensing, and advanced ISR systems. As a result, the Quantum Warfare Market is gaining significant traction across defense and intelligence agencies globally.

Market Segmentation
The Quantum Warfare Market is segmented based on capability type, systems, platform, application, and end user. By capability type, the market includes post-quantum cryptography (PQC) & crypto-agility, quantum sensing & quantum-enhanced ISR, quantum timing & PNT resilience, quantum communications, quantum computing for defense workloads, and counter-quantum protection measures. Among these, quantum sensing & quantum-enhanced ISR dominates the Quantum Warfare Market due to its rapid deployment capability and effectiveness in real-time detection and tracking applications.
Based on systems, the Quantum Warfare Market is categorized into hardware, software, systems integration & testing, and services. The hardware segment holds the largest share as quantum warfare capabilities rely heavily on physical components such as sensors, clocks, photonics systems, and rugged modules designed for extreme military environments. However, the services segment is expected to grow at the fastest rate due to increasing demand for integration, testing, and lifecycle support.
By platform, the Quantum Warfare Market includes land, airborne, naval, space, and C4ISR infrastructure. The C4ISR infrastructure segment dominates the market as militaries prioritize upgrading communication networks and mission-critical systems to be quantum-resistant. These upgrades enable secure communications and prevent adversaries from decrypting sensitive data in the future.
Based on application, the Quantum Warfare Market is segmented into secure communications & data protection, ISR (intelligence, surveillance, reconnaissance), navigation in GNSS-denied environments, and others. Secure communications is a key application area due to increasing threats to traditional encryption methods.
By end user, the Quantum Warfare Market includes defense armed forces, R&D organizations and intelligence agencies, national laboratories, and system integrators. Among these, R&D organizations and intelligence agencies dominate the Quantum Warfare Market as they lead early-stage investments, innovation, and deployment of quantum technologies in defense.

Market Growth
The growth of the Quantum Warfare Market is primarily driven by the increasing urgency to transition toward post-quantum cryptography and quantum-resistant communication systems. Governments are actively mandating the migration from traditional encryption methods to PQC frameworks, transforming quantum readiness into funded defense programs. This regulatory push is significantly accelerating the growth of the Quantum Warfare Market.
Another major driver of the Quantum Warfare Market is the growing need for secure communication and data protection in military operations. As adversaries develop quantum computing capabilities, existing encryption methods are becoming vulnerable, prompting defense organizations to invest in quantum-safe technologies.
Technological advancements in quantum sensing, timing systems, and quantum networks are also fueling the expansion of the Quantum Warfare Market. These technologies enhance detection capabilities, improve navigation accuracy in GPS-denied environments, and provide strategic advantages in electronic warfare scenarios.
Furthermore, increasing investments in C4ISR infrastructure modernization are contributing significantly to the growth of the Quantum Warfare Market. Military organizations are focusing on upgrading their communication networks and intelligence systems to ensure resilience against emerging quantum threats.
Restraining Factors
Despite strong growth prospects, the Quantum Warfare Market faces several challenges that may hinder its expansion. One of the key restraining factors is the complexity associated with transitioning to post-quantum cryptography. Many existing defense systems have embedded legacy cryptographic technologies, making migration to quantum-resistant systems a slow, costly, and technically challenging process.
Another major restraint in the Quantum Warfare Market is the high cost of research, development, and deployment of quantum technologies. Quantum systems require specialized infrastructure, advanced materials, and highly skilled personnel, which increases overall costs and limits adoption in certain regions.
Additionally, integration challenges across different military platforms and systems pose significant barriers. Ensuring interoperability and reliability of quantum technologies within existing defense ecosystems requires extensive testing and validation, which can delay implementation timelines.
Regional Analysis
Geographically, the Quantum Warfare Market is segmented into North America, Europe, Asia Pacific, the Middle East, and the rest of the world. North America dominates the Quantum Warfare Market due to strong government mandates, early adoption of quantum technologies, and significant investments in defense modernization programs. The U.S. leads the region with extensive funding for quantum research and deployment initiatives.
Europe holds the second-largest share in the Quantum Warfare Market, supported by increasing focus on secure communication networks and collaborative defense initiatives. Countries in the region are investing in quantum-safe technologies to enhance resilience and interoperability across allied defense systems.
The Asia Pacific region is expected to witness the fastest growth in the Quantum Warfare Market due to rising investments in national quantum programs and defense modernization. Countries such as China, India, Japan, and Australia are actively developing quantum technologies for military applications, contributing to rapid market expansion.
The Middle East is also emerging as a high-growth region in the Quantum Warfare Market, driven by increasing focus on cybersecurity, data protection, and advanced defense technologies. Governments in this region are adopting quantum-safe cryptography to secure critical infrastructure.
